Output 514e774198a895e453c196a0061b184f10e874ee6c288c7ad29580ab9a30cb71:9

value
5807538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a7762eba069447e169e36a76375345ec2884c0 OP_EQUAL
address
MTeioJeLHyTfe1eBFow6vWd1aUK8puacLz
transaction
514e774198a895e453c196a0061b184f10e874ee6c288c7ad29580ab9a30cb71
spent
true